Emma Pittman (born 29 December 1992) is a former Australian rules footballer who played for Brisbane and Gold Coast in the AFL Women's (AFLW).

Pittman was born and raised in Mackay, Queensland but moved to Brisbane at the age of 15 following the tragic loss of her mother.

[2] She began playing association football when she moved to Brisbane in an attempt to make friends but her ability soon shone through as she made her way through representative teams.

In 2017 she earned selection in the league's team of the year and also represented her state in an exhibition match against Western Australia.

[5] Pittman made her AFLW debut in the Lions' round 4, 2018 win over Fremantle at South Pine Sports Complex.
